(23 Sep 2014) Algerian police and soldiers have been searching a mountainous region on Tuesday for a kidnapped Frenchman near a village of Ait Ouabane, 180 kilometres (112 miles) east of Algiers. Residents say roads have been filled with military trucks, as helicopters fly overhead and security forces fan out through the rugged region - which has long been a hotbed for extremist groups. Some of the residents are adamant that Herve Gourdel was not kidnapped in their village but 50 kilometres away, in the Bouira area. An Algeria security official says the group that is holding the Frenchman had split away from al-Qaida's North Africa branch just two weeks ago and declared allegiance to the Islamic State group in Syria and Iraq -- a rival of al-Qaida. Gourdel is a mountaineering guide who was taken on Sunday night while driving through the Djura Djura mountains in a region that is one of the last active areas of operation for al-Qaida in Algeria. Four Algerian companions who were captured with him were later released.
